Understanding the Mechanics of the Crash

The basic premise of a crash game revolves around a rapidly escalating multiplier. Each round begins with a multiplier of 1x, and this value increases over time, often with a visually engaging graphical representation. Players place their initial bet before the round starts, and can then choose to ‘cash out’ at any point during the escalating multiplier phase. The longer a player waits to cash out, the higher the multiplier – and therefore, the greater their potential winnings. However, this comes with increasing risk. The game is programmed to ‘crash’ at a random point, and if a player hasn't cashed out before this happens, they lose their entire bet for that round. This intrinsic element of unpredictability is what drives the excitement and strategic thinking within the game.

The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)

At the heart of every fair crash game lies a robust Random Number Generator (RNG). This crucial component ensures that the point at which the multiplier crashes is entirely random and unbiased. Reputable crash game providers utilize certified RNGs that are regularly audited by independent third-party organizations to verify their fairness and integrity. These audits meticulously examine the RNG’s algorithms and outputs to guarantee that they adhere to strict statistical standards, preventing any manipulation or predictable patterns. Players looking for a secure and trustworthy gaming environment should always prioritize platforms that prominently display their RNG certification and auditing information. This provides a crucial layer of confidence, knowing that the results are genuinely random and not predetermined.

The fairness of the RNG directly impacts the player experience and builds trust within the online casino community. Without a verifiable RNG, there’s a risk of the game being rigged, leading to unfair outcomes and a loss of player confidence. Therefore, understanding the importance of RNGs is paramount for anyone venturing into the world of crash games, and choosing platforms that prioritize transparency and independent verification is essential. Strategies for Playing the Crash

While the crash game hinges on luck, employing strategic approaches can significantly enhance your chances of success and manage your risk effectively. One common strategy is the ‘low and slow’ approach, where players aim to cash out with small, consistent profits at multipliers between 1.2x and 1.5x. This method prioritizes minimizing losses and building a steady bankroll over time. Conversely, the ‘high-risk, high-reward’ strategy involves waiting for significantly higher multipliers, potentially exceeding 5x or even 10x, but accepting a considerably greater risk of losing the entire bet. The optimal strategy ultimately depends on your individual risk tolerance, bankroll size, and overall gaming goals. It's crucial to understand that no strategy can guarantee a win, and responsible gambling practices should always be prioritized.

Bankroll Management Techniques

Effective bankroll management is arguably the most crucial aspect of playing the crash game. It involves setting a predetermined budget for your gaming sessions and adhering to it strictly. A common rule of thumb is to never bet more than 1-5% of your total bankroll on a single round. This helps to mitigate the impact of potential losses and extends your playtime. Furthermore, consider setting win and loss limits for each session. If you reach your win limit, cash out and enjoy your profits. Conversely, if you reach your loss limit, stop playing and avoid chasing your losses. Disciplined bankroll management is the cornerstone of responsible gambling and increases your chances of long-term success.

Psychological Factors and Common Pitfalls

The thrill of the crash game can be incredibly addictive, and understanding the psychological factors at play is vital for responsible gaming. The near-miss effect, where the multiplier crashes just after you’ve cashed out, can be particularly frustrating and can lead to impulsive decisions to chase losses. Similarly, the gambler's fallacy – the belief that past events influence future outcomes – can tempt players to increase their bets after a series of losses, hoping to recoup their money quickly. It’s essential to recognize these cognitive biases and avoid falling into their trap. Maintaining a rational and disciplined mindset is crucial, even in the face of setbacks. Remember that each round is independent, and past results have no bearing on future outcomes.

Recognizing Problem Gambling

It’s important to be aware of the signs of problem gambling. These include spending more money than you can afford to lose, lying to friends and family about your gambling habits, neglecting personal responsibilities, and feeling restless or irritable when trying to cut back or stop gambling.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, there are resources available to help. Organizations like the National Council on Problem Gambling and Gamblers Anonymous offer support, guidance, and treatment options. Seeking help is a sign of strength, and it’s never too late to address a gambling problem.

The Future of Crash Games and Technological Innovations

The crash game genre is constantly evolving, driven by technological advancements and innovative game design. We’re seeing an increasing trend towards provably fair systems, utilizing blockchain technology to ensure transparency and verifiability of game outcomes. This allows players to independently verify the fairness of each round, further enhancing trust and security. Furthermore, the integration of social features, such as live chat and leaderboards, is creating a more communal and engaging gaming experience. The development of more sophisticated betting options and auto-trading bots is also on the horizon, potentially offering players even greater control and customization. As the technology matures, we can expect to see even more innovative and immersive crash game experiences emerge.
